Absolutely worth it for the money. If your rank is good, opt for better colleges outside Bidar.
Placements: Actually, our college was opened in the year 2022, so no batch has graduated. In 2026, the first batch of this college will be graduating. As the college is good, it is believed and expected that placement will take place, and good companies will come to our college.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ure is good. Classes are big and good, and the benches are sturdy and of good quality. Projectors are present in every classroom, and green boards are also present. Labs have high-quality systems. Wi-Fi is not accessible for students. The library has a good number of books. Everything is new. The hostel is good. The canteen is currently not available; a new building for the canteen has been constructed, but has not yet been inaugurated. Sports are not available in our college.
Faculty: Teachers are well-qualified and knowledgeable. The teaching quality is average. However, in most colleges, we have to put in our own efforts and self-study. The semester exams are quite easy as well as difficult according to the subjects; previous year questions (PYQ) and model question papers (MPQ) are enough to pass and score well in the exams. The curriculum is according to VTU.

Good infrastructure and value for money. Best government college in the Bidar area.
Placements: Currently, no batch has yet been placed. As our college has opened in the year 2022, still no batch has been graduated yet. Next year i.e., 2026 the first batch will graduate and we can look forward to placements in the upcoming year. As our college is based on government, we are hoping many government companies will come for recruitment.
Infrastructure: This is an awesome college, the infrastructure is more worth it than the fees you put in. We have high-quality benches and larger classrooms, and each classroom has a green board as well as whiteboards for projector display. There are cameras in every classroom. We have filter water available at free of cost daily. Labs have quality systems. Each CPU in our labs is worth more than Rs. 50,000. Canteen and library are constructed new, but still not open. But for the freshers, there is canteen and library. No sports are available for now.
Faculty: As our college is based on VTU, we have to follow every guideline of VTU only, even subjects, schedules, examinations everything VTU decides. We just wait for their order. Faculty is good. Some are excellent and some are not, as in every college. Don't expect every faculty to be the best. One has to put self-effort, into whichever college. The semester exams are average, some easy and some difficult. We follow the PYQ and MQP for preparations and the question papers and corrections are of VTU only.

Placements: We are the second batch of our course at this college. There are no signs of having placements here as the college is tier 3. But if any of the companies come to our campus they may offer posts in IT field related to our course which is AI and this.
Infrastructure: We do not have an open library but they have a building specifically for the library. There is no ground so none of the sports are playable on the college campus. The college does not have a Wi-Fi facility but is mentioned to be a Wi-Fi-enabled campus college.
Faculty: We do not have permanent professors. All the teaching staffs are on a temporary basis. Most of the lecturers are freshers and newly graduated students. First year has easy and basic common subjects to all branches but as we go on to higher semesters, we have core subjects which are hard.

Placements: Placements are not yet started as the college does not have any batch in the final year. We as students are trying to have internships. As we are pursuing CSE (computer science and engineering) we can have roles as software engineering and others in the tech field.
Infrastructure: The campus has registered itself as Wi-Fi enabled campus. But there is no Wi-Fi available in the area. Library has not yet opened but a new building has been constructed for it. All the classrooms and labs are well-ventilated and have a lot of free space.
Faculty: Here, most of the lecturers are freshers and HODs are also professors who are somewhat experienced. First semester is the easiest and the toughness level of the curriculum goes on increasing per semester. The higher semesters have more core subjects compared to the lower ones.
